This was like 100 people left in the tourney.

Villain is an okay player; not a fish, not a good reg.

BB: 87,672
UTG: 588,741
UTG+1: 63,765
MP: 203,619
Hero (MP+1): 165,015
MP+2: 71,439
CO: 110,963
BTN: 62,535
SB: 172,638

9 players post ante of 750, SB posts SB 3,000, BB posts BB 6,000

Pre Flop: (pot: 15,750) Hero has Ah Qh
fold, fold, fold, Hero raises to 12,720, fold, fold, fold, SB calls 9,720, BB calls 6,720

Flop : (44,910, 3 players) 6h 4d 9s
SB checks, BB checks, Hero checks

Turn : (44,910, 3 players) Js
SB checks, BB checks, Hero bets 27,600, SB calls 27,600, fold

River : (100,110, 2 players) 6s
SB checks, Hero bets 123,945 and is all-in

Spoiler:
SB calls 123,945

Hero shows Ah Qh (One Pair, Sixes)
(Pre 69%, Flop 79%, Turn 73%)

SB shows 5s As (Flush, Ace High)
(Pre 31%, Flop 21%, Turn 27%)

SB wins 348,000


On the flop I def could've cbet, but I thought I'd check and I can still win even though I check. But maybe should've cbet.

On the turn I thought I'd rep a jack and get weak pairs to fold, and also I could have the best hand and I could win the pot right there.

On the river I thought he maybe has a weak pair or a jack with a weakish kicker. But I mean he needs to have those AND fold about 60% of the time as opposed to flushes for my shove to be profitable, so prolly a spew and I should just check it back? I am repping the flush obv, which I could def have when taking this line. It would be better to have the ace of spades in my hand though (or queen of spades).

In my opinion it's either a shove or check on the river because if I bet smaller, he will start calling me with a jack pretty often IMO.

I think up until the turn is reasonable. However my choice is usually to CBet flop when I have a backdoor draw and check back when you just have naked overcards. The backdoor draws allow you to keep barrelling more often.

As played when they call your turn bet they're not just going to be randomly floating, so they'll have Jx, 9x or some sort of draw.

You beat the straight draws so you could just check for SDV vs these.

You don't block any of his flush draws so he's going to be showing up with those quite often.

Your river bet sizing is very polarising between flush and nothing because you wouldn't play Jx like this. Therefore I don't think you're going to get enough Jx to fold and you might not even get random 9x or 88/77 to fold against some villains.

I probably would have C-bet the flop, and I don't hate stabbing at the turn.

I don't like the shove on the river with the 3rd spade falling. Since you were repping the jack on the turn, you should consider that a call from the villain on the turn is either repping a jack as well or a flush draw. Since you have neither, you have to rep the flush. While you can do this, as you said it is better to do it with the Ace in your hand. Neither you or BB (likely) had any spades in your hand to block a flush, so it makes the bluff riskier.

I would have c-bet the flop. As played, I check back on the river. Just my $.02.
